Suprisingly enough the current take-off run avaiable (TORA) for RWY 02 (1723m) is greater than that on RWY 20 (1650m). This is due to a requirement for the latter to have a 60 metre overrun (the "strip end", plus a runway end safety area (RESA) ) for the same purpose and to protect the undershoot for the reciprocal runway. The latter ends about the top of the bank which goes down to the M27.

As mentioned in a previous post the RESA width is supposed to be twice the runway width. Due to the top of the bank running diagonally across the RESA, the full double runway width is not attainable for the complete RESA, hence the "fudge" that I previously mentioned. If/when the starter strip is installed CAA may insist on clawing back the missing part of the RESA width which will reduce the increase in 20 TORA from the intended full 170 metres.

In respect of any increase in 02 landing distance available (LDA), as the same applies to 02 (ie strip end + RESA) an increase of 20m may be possible, more is possible dependant upon any extra land (at twice runway width) available beyon the end of paved surface.
